楼主: zrsdsb
851 4

[SAS EM] sas数据处理求助 [推广有奖]

  • 0关注
  • 0粉丝

高中生

80%

还不是VIP/贵宾

-

威望
0
论坛币
178 个
通用积分
0.7000
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
123 点
帖子
3
精华
0
在线时间
68 小时
注册时间
2013-10-2
最后登录
2023-10-2

10论坛币
一个sas数据集, 其中一个变量是日期,但是数据有缺失,现在有另一个数据集有完整的日期数据,求问如何将有缺失的日期数据补全。。

关键词:sas数据处理 数据处理求助 数据处理 sas数据集 日期数据
沙发
deem 学生认证  发表于 2017-8-15 15:55:46 |只看作者 |坛友微信交流群
按照另一个变量合并2个数据就行了呀

使用道具

藤椅
charles03 发表于 2017-8-17 21:18:51 |只看作者 |坛友微信交流群
proc sort data=a; by ID; run;
proc sort data=b; by ID; run;

data c;
merge a(in=a) b(in=b);
by ID;
if a and b;
run;
如果两表中都有ID变量,a中日期有缺失,b中日期完整,用merge即可。

使用道具

板凳
我在数下 发表于 2017-8-17 22:46:47 |只看作者 |坛友微信交流群
用merge语句

使用道具

报纸
zrsdsb 发表于 2017-8-18 11:17:08 |只看作者 |坛友微信交流群
不好意思,问题没说清楚。。第二个数据集只有完整的日期数据,其他什么变量都没有, 我是想检测原始数据里的日期是不是有缺失。。。多谢各位相助

使用道具

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群

京ICP备16021002-2号 京B2-20170662号 京公网安备 11010802022788号 论坛法律顾问:王进律师 知识产权保护声明   免责及隐私声明

GMT+8, 2024-4-23 23:49